Event Queue Length Solana: Quick Guide
Wanneer je een token launcht of een markt opzet op een DEX op Solana, zijn er meerdere parameters die bepalen hoe die markt zich gedraagt. Eén van die parameters is de Event Queue Length.
Wat is de Event Queue Length?
De Event Queue Length op Solana verwijst naar de capaciteit van de event queue, waarin alle acties zoals orders, transacties en annuleringen binnen een markt worden vastgelegd (oftewel een openbook market). Deze queue werkt als een lijst waarbij wat er als eerste in komt er ook als eerste uit gaat (FIFO: First In, First Out).
Met andere woorden: de Event Queue Length bepaalt hoeveel marktevents (zoals orders en transacties) op een gegeven moment opgeslagen en verwerkt kunnen worden voordat de queue vol zit. Als de queue zijn limiet bereikt, kunnen nieuwe events vertraging oplopen of zelfs gedropt worden tot er weer ruimte is, wat invloed heeft op hoe de markt functioneert.
Hoe werkt de Event Queue Length?
Stel je voor dat je een reeks pakketten met informatie hebt (die de orders en transacties voorstellen) die in een rij staan te wachten om gescand en verwerkt te worden. De scanner (die de event queue voorstelt) kan slechts een bepaald aantal pakketten tegelijk aan, afhankelijk van zijn capaciteit.

Als de rij pakketten langer is dan wat de machine in één batch aankan, moeten sommige pakketten wachten op hun beurt. Dat is precies wat er gebeurt wanneer de Event Queue Length te laag is: de pakketten (events) die niet in de eerste batch passen blijven wachten, wat de informatiestroom in het systeem kan vertragen.

Er zijn 3 formaten Event Queue Length, afhankelijk van de grootte van de Openbook market die je kiest. Kies je ervoor om de openbook market voor 0.4 te creëren
Kleine queue (128):
- Er kunnen slechts 128 orders of transacties tegelijk verwerkt worden.
- Als er tijdens een piek 200 orders tegelijk binnenkomen, moeten er 72 wachten of worden ze mogelijk niet op tijd verwerkt.
Grote queue (1024):
- Hier kunnen 1024 events tegelijk afgehandeld worden.
- Diezelfde 200 orders zouden zonder vertraging verwerkt worden, met ruimte over voor extra events.
Hoe beïnvloedt de Event Queue Length een liquidity pool?
De Event Queue Length is superbelangrijk voor de liquiditeit en stabiliteit van de markt van een token, vooral in een AMM of liquidity pool:
- Lage event queue: Als deze te laag is, kan dat beperken hoeveel transacties er tijdens vraagpieken verwerkt worden, wat een bottleneck creëert. Dat kan slippage en koersschommelingen veroorzaken omdat niet alle orders op tijd uitgevoerd worden. Voor een net gelanceerde token kan dat lager trading volume en minder liquiditeit betekenen.
- Hoge event queue: Een langere queue maakt het mogelijk om meer orders tegelijk te verwerken, waardoor de markt liquide en stabiel blijft, zelfs bij veel activiteit. Dat is cruciaal voor tokens met hoog trading volume of tokens die veel actie verwachten bij hun launch.
Hoe beïnvloedt het de activiteit van bots?
Bots, en dan vooral snipers, zijn geprogrammeerd om trades zo snel mogelijk uit te voeren tijdens de launch van een token of een marktevent. De Event Queue Length kan bepalen hoe goed deze bots presteren:
- Lage event queue: Met minder ruimte in de queue kunnen bots moeite hebben om hun transacties verwerkt te krijgen, zeker als ze concurreren met andere bots of high-frequency traders. Dat kan het speelveld voor handmatige traders gelijktrekken en het voordeel van bots verkleinen, al gaat dat ten koste van het totale volume.
- Hoge event queue: Er kunnen meer botorders zonder vertraging verwerkt worden, wat het volume kan opdrijven, maar ook de kans vergroot dat bots de markt domineren en handmatige traders in het nadeel zijn.
Conclusie
De Event Queue Length is een sleutelparameter die bepaalt hoe efficiënt een markt orders en transacties kan afhandelen. Door deze instelling aan te passen, stuur je de transactiestroom, de stabiliteit van de liquidity pool van je token en de invloed van bots op je markt.
Een kortere rij kan de interferentie van bots verminderen, maar kan ook de marktactiviteit beperken. Het is dus belangrijk om de juiste balans te vinden op basis van je doelen.



